Shipping Instructions

82 • Chapter 6 • Disassembly and Sterilization of CUSA
Place the Console on a solid surface. The surface must be flat, non-slip
and free from obstruction.
Clean and sterilize the equipment as per the instructions in Chapter 6. If the
equipment is being transported from a hospital, ensure that a Sterilization
Certificate is completed and a copy is included within the package.
Handpieces
Place handpiece in a plastic bag and surround with foam/bubble wrap. Pack
in a stout cardboard box adding sufficient soft packaging to cushion and
protect the contents.
Consoles, Modules and Footswitches
It is recommended that flight cases be used on all occasions for air
transportation of the NXT systems. During Service Module handling pallets
should also be used. Flight cases can be purchased upon request from
Integra.
Notice
In instances where flight cases are not used please package as described
for the Handpieces making sure that the contents will be well protected
against dropping and manhandling. It is strongly advised that the original
cardboard packaging is only used once for re-packing.
If you do not have suitable packaging please contact your Integra
representative.
